Double figure Bass from the UK (+ HD video)
 
I have not been kayak fishing much this year, but last weekend I managed a quick trip out.To be honest, I really did not fancy it, but my kayak fishing friends Adam and Dave persuaded me !

The weather was fantastic, but the tide was very strong and I spent most of the time drifting, because my anchor kept tripping.

Adam was doing well, and Dave was having an absolute stormer of a day - he caught loads of ray, including this Blonde Ray...

I was getting more and more tired and frustrated, so I took a break (I almost packed up and went home I have to admit !) - suitably refereshed after my beach food break, I solved my anchor problems and resumed fishing. Adam and Dave said their goodbyes, but urged me to stay... I am glad I did.... because I landed a new personal best bass - over 10lbs. My first ever double figure bass.

In the UK, a bass over 10lbs is the holy grail - and the fish of a lifetime for me. I still have not calmed down...
